The President William Jefferson Clinton Hunger Leadership Award


Expires: 2009-10-31

http://www.ncsu.edu/csleps/service/clinton_2009_information.htm

The President William Jefferson Clinton Hunger Leadership Award was created to honor President Clinton for his commitment to humanitarian causes, most especially his commitment to eradicating hunger.  The NC State University Center for Student Leadership, Ethics & Public Service (CSLEPS) in partnership with Stop Hunger Now, a non-profit hunger relief organization, presented the first award to John Coggin, an NC State student as part of President Clinton’s visit to North Carolina State University on January 26, 2009.

The award will be presented annually to a student from a U.S. based college or university. Stop Hunger Now will provide a cash award for the recipient to use towards an educational experience that will advance their knowledge and understanding of hunger and related issues.  The award will be presented at the Hunger Summit at Auburn University on Feb 26-28, 2010.
